The David E. James Papers on the Southern Nevada Environment (approximately 1970-2022) contain reports, scholarship, and research materials related to Southern Nevada environment's air, water, and wastewater treatment quality.

Materials were donated in 2024 and 2025 by David E. James; accession numbers 2024-087 and 2025-088.
In 2024, Sarah Jones accessioned the collection, rehoused the materials, and created a brief finding aid in ArchivesSpace. In 2025, Landon Paljusaj accessioned the addition, and Sarah Jones updated the finding aid. This collection is minimally processed.
